Integral theory: surprisingly simple, elegant

Integral theory: surprisingly simple, elegant

The word integral means comprehensive, inclusive, non-marginalizing, embracing. Integral approaches to any field attempt to be exactly that: to include as many perspectives, styles, and methodologies as possible within a coherent view of the topic—Ken Wilber Integral...
